Job Title: Maintenance Line Mechanic

Location: Ridgefield, NJ

About The Job

We deliver 4.3 billion healthcare solutions to people every year, thanks to the flawless planning and meticulous eye for detail of our Manufacturing & Supply teams. With your talent and ambition, we can do even more to protect people from infectious diseases and bring hope to patients and their families.

Responsible for ensuring the efficient operation and maintenance of pharmaceutical production line equipment and machinery. Summary of responsibilities include machine change over, troubleshooting, repairing, performing corrective and preventive maintenance on formulation, filling, and packaging equipment. Candidate must ensure compliance with SOPs, regulatory guidelines, including Good Manufacturing Practices (cGMPs) and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A) standards.

Main Responsibilities

  • Troubleshoot and repair issues on pharmaceutical packaging and filling equipment to ensure reliable operation.
  • Pull maintenance work orders from Computer Maintenance Management System (CMMS) and accurately document work performed in CMMS or on batch documentation
  • Perform preventative maintenance on equipment to clean, lubricate, replace worn parts, and inspect equipment to reduce breakdowns.
  • Perform corrective maintenance on equipment and facilities as directed by the CMMS and supervisor.
  • Coordinate closely with production and planning team to perform equipment changeovers between different products or batches.
  • Supervise external equipment technician during shutdown preventive maintenance work.
  • Comply with company policies, SOPs, cGMP and OSHA requirements.
  • Ability to communicate and work closely with peers and other departments.
  • Demonstrate good organizational, written, and oral communications skills.
  • Participate in deviation and root cause investigations as required.
  • Open to shift work including overtime, nights, weekend, and holiday to support production.
  • Complete all required training related to technical, compliance, and safety.

HSE

  • It is required that individuals care for their own safety and wellbeing. Individuals must promote a safe working environment for employees and contractors working in their area of responsibility.
  • The individual must support all Sanofi and site HSE policies as well as ensure that work performed is compliant with local HSE regulations.
  • Individuals must complete all required HSE trainings. Everyone is required to report all accidents and incidents and support investigations in their areas of responsibility.
  • Physical demands include lifting up to 50 lbs, climbing ladders, standing for extended periods, working in confined space, with protective equipment.

Education/Experience

About You

  • High School diploma, GED, or certification in industrial maintenance
  • Minimum of 5 years industry experience performing maintenance on pharmaceutical, food, or regulated manufacturing facility, 10+ years of experience preferred
  • Understand FDA regulations and cGMP requirements
  • Experience with aseptic gowning or gown qualified
  • Proficient computer skills utilizing MS Office suite applications, Building Management Systems, Distributed Control Systems (DCS), SCADA, and Computerized Maintenance Management Systems (CMMS)
  • Experience using hand tools, portable power tools, and shop tools to fix and machine parts
